Neil Keeling is a scholar working on Surgery, Oncology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Neil Keeling has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Surgery, 4 papers in Oncology and 3 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Neil Keeling’s work include Intestinal and Peritoneal Adhesions (4 papers), Intraperitoneal and Appendiceal Malignancies (3 papers) and Appendicitis Diagnosis and Management (3 papers). Neil Keeling is often cited by papers focused on Intestinal and Peritoneal Adhesions (4 papers), Intraperitoneal and Appendiceal Malignancies (3 papers) and Appendicitis Diagnosis and Management (3 papers). Neil Keeling coll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Ireland. Neil Keeling's co-authors include Stewart R. Walsh, Tim A. Justin, C Wastell, R W Motson and John Wrightson and has published in prestigious journals such as Gut, The American Journal of Surgery and Diseases of the Colon & Rectum.
